About
SANA-Video is a small, ultra-efficient diffusion model designed for rapid generation of high-quality, minute-long videos at resolutions up to 720×1280.
Key innovations and efficiency drivers include:
(1) Linear DiT: Leverages linear attention as the core operation, offering significantly more efficiency than vanilla attention when processing the massive number of tokens required for video generation.
(2) Constant-Memory KV Cache for Block Linear Attention: Implements a block-wise autoregressive approach that uses the cumulative properties of linear attention to maintain global context at a fixed memory cost, eliminating the traditional KV cache bottleneck and enabling efficient, minute-long video synthesis.
SANA-Video achieves exceptional efficiency and cost savings: its training cost is only 1% of MovieGen's (12 days on 64 H100 GPUs). Compared to modern state-of-the-art small diffusion models (e.g., Wan 2.1 and SkyReel-V2), SANA-Video maintains competitive performance while being 16× faster in measured latency. SANA-Video is deployable on RTX 5090 GPUs, accelerating the inference speed for a 5-second 720p video from 71s down to 29s (2.4× speedup), setting a new standard for low-cost, high-quality video generation.

This model is released under the Apache License 2.0.
The model is intended for research purposes only. Possible research areas and tasks include
Generation of artworks and use in design and other artistic processes.
Applications in educational or creative tools.
Research on generative models.
Safe deployment of models which have the potential to generate harmful content.
Probing and understanding the limitations and biases of generative models.
Excluded uses are described below.
The model was not trained to be factual or true representations of people or events, and therefore using the model to generate such content is out-of-scope for the abilities of this model.
While the capabilities of video generation models are impressive, they can also reinforce or exacerbate social biases.
